Haiti - Humanitarian : The International Community announces its first measures of assistance 09/11/2012 12:54:47 Wednesday, the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A) has announced Wednesday, the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A) has announced Thursday the European Commission (EU) has announced a relief of 6 million for Haiti and Cuba. This emergency fund will allow to immediately assist the people most affected in both countries through the provision of food and basic household items, as well as house repairs and restoration of water and sanitation infrastructure. The funds will also help restore local agriculture by providing farmers with seeds and tools. In response to the appeal launched by the Government of Haiti, France immediately mobilized €700,000 to rebuild the bridge of Arcahaie away a te th passage of Sandy, an infrastructure essential to traffic and trade between the North and the South In addition, 160,000 euros will be awarded to the revival of agriculture in the department of Nippes (south), one of the hardest hit by the storm. In this department, 100% crop of beans and carrots were destroyed, 90% of the fruit fell to the ground before maturity, 50% of feet of bananas were lying on the ground. In the wake of these immediate measures, France is preparing an additional €8 million to build the school canteen, which favors the purchase of local products in order to give farmers a market for their future crops.
